First and foremost, having the best tools is critical. A high-quality digital camera physique combined with versatile lenses is a basis every wedding photographer should spend money on. Typically, professionals go for a full-frame digital camera that allows them to perform in various lighting conditions. Having lenses starting from wide-angle to telephoto becomes important, as this variety aids in capturing every little thing from expansive venue shots to intimate close-ups of the couple.

Another crucial component is having a backup plan. Weddings are unpredictable, and things can typically go wrong. Having a second camera, additional batteries, and reminiscence cards prevents potential disasters. This backup gear must be readily accessible throughout the day, offering peace of thoughts for each the photographer and the couple.


Light plays a big function in photography, particularly for weddings. Understanding pure gentle is vital, because it supplies the most flattering and romantic tones. Photographers ought to scout the venue beforehand to identify the best mild sources and how they shift all through the day. Additionally, carrying artificial lighting gear, such as flash items or reflectors, may help when natural mild is not sufficient.

Attire is another wedding photography essential typically missed. Photographers should costume appropriately to blend in with the marriage visitors, as well as for consolation. Weddings can require lengthy hours on one's feet, so opting for comfy yet skilled clothing helps keep energy all through the day. Wearing darkish colors may additionally be useful, as they don’t distract from the couple or the event’s ambiance.

Should I rent a second shooter?


Having a second shooter can be beneficial, particularly for bigger weddings. They present additional angles, capture candid moments you might miss, and assist with managing the timeline, making certain a extra complete photographic protection.
